About this ebook

A testament to love, resilience, and the beautiful diversity of the modern family.

Raising Rainbow Kids is a groundbreaking and deeply moving collection of fifteen true stories that explore the vibrant tapestry of LGBTQ+ parenting across the globe. Journey from a quiet apartment in Barcelona to a hidden compound in Nigeria, from the political spotlight of Washington D.C. to the rugged coast of South Africa, and discover the unique challenges and profound joys of building a family without a traditional blueprint.

This book goes beyond the political debates to showcase the intimate, human reality of these families. Meet:

Leila and Sofia in Spain, navigating the emotional and financial rollercoaster of IVF.

Marcus, a single gay man in Chicago, opening his heart and home through foster care.

Kenji and Arata in Tokyo, facing legal labyrinths to bring their daughter home from Canada via surrogacy.

Amina and Fatima in Nigeria, protecting their children and their love in a society where they must remain invisible.

The Johnson-Davises, a polyamorous family in Oregon, redefining what it means to be parents together.
